Exam Pattern and Marks Distribution for RBSE Class 12 Subject Humanities
Students should know the complete RBSE 12th exam pattern of the exam and weightage of every topic in the RBSE syllabus for preparation of the examination. The exam duration for RBSE Class 12 Humanities is three hours and fifteen minutes. Marks distribution among various topics subject-wise is given below:

RBSE Economics Class 12 Syllabus
The syllabus of RBSE Class 12 Economics is divided into two sections, Microeconomics and Macroeconomics. The total marks allocated for the examination is 100 — 80 marks for theory paper and 20 marks for the internal assessment.
| Topics |
Marks |
|---|---|
| Introduction to Micro Economics |
5 |
| Consumer Behaviour |
12 |
| Producer Behaviour |
12 |
| Market and Price Determination |
11 |
| Concepts of National Income |
11 |
| Money and Banking |
10 |
| Determination of Income and Employment |
10 |
| Concept of Budget and International Trade |
7 |
| Cashless Transaction |
2 |
RBSE Political Science Class 12 Syllabus
The syllabus of RBSE Class 12 Political Science consists of two parts, i.e. Part 1-Indian Constitution and Part 2- Politics in India
| Topics |
Marks |
|---|---|
| Major Concepts of Political Science |
10 |
| Modern Political Concepts |
10 |
| Political Ideologies |
10 |
| Emerging Dimensions of Indian Politics |
10 |
| Indian Constitution |
10 |
| Governance in India |
10 |
| Challenges before Indian Democracy |
8 |
| Foreign Policies of India & UN |
12 |
RBSE History Class 12 Syllabus
The total marks allocated for RBSE History examination is 100 — 80 marks for theory paper and 20 marks for the internal assessment
| Topics |
Marks |
|---|---|
| Glorious past of India |
10 |
| Golden Era of History India |
15 |
| Invasions and Assimilations |
10 |
| Muslim Invasion- Aim and Resistance |
10 |
| Colonial Invasions |
10 |
| Modern National Movement |
10 |
| Rajasthan’s Brief History |
10 |

RBSE Psychology Class 12 Syllabus
The total marks allocated for RBSE Psychology examination is 100 — 70 marks for theory paper and 30 marks for the practical assessment
| Topics |
Marks |
|---|---|
| Intelligence and Aptitude |
6 |
| Self and personality |
6 |
| Stress, Human Capabilities and Well-being |
6 |
| Psychological Disorders |
6 |
| Therapeutic Approach and Counselling |
6 |
| Attitude and Social Cognition |
6 |
| Group Pressure and Social influence |
5 |
| Psychology and Life |
5 |
| Applied Psychology |
5 |
| Developing Psychological Skills |
5 |

RBSE Home Science Class 12 Syllabus
The total marks allocated for RBSE Home Science examination is 100 — 70 marks (56 + 14 for internal assessment) for theory paper and 30 marks for the practical assessment.
| Topics |
Marks |
|---|---|
| Human Development and Family Studies |
15 |
| Food and Nutrition |
20 |
| Clothing and Textile |
09 |
| Family Resource Management |
09 |
| Home Science Extension Education |
03 |
